A study of regional disparities in growth in the state of Maharashtra

Mr. Ahuja Ravi S., Mr. Nikam Ashish A.

Programme Coordinator (Asst. Professor), Skill Development Centre, Savitribai Phule Pune University, Pune

Online published on 28 January, 2015.

Abstract

Maharashtra is big state comprising of 35 districts, having different socio-economic, cultural, population parameters, source of livelihood and climatic conditions. Each district in the state of Maharashtra is different from other and offers different strengths to the economy of the State. It would be incorrect to form a opinion of growth of the state without considering the growth at district levels which highlights the widening or reducing inter-district disparities which would facilitate formation and implementation of policies catering to local levels. The paper attempts to analyze the inter-district inequality of per capita income in Maharashtra for the period 2001–2013
